843-855:⚠️ Potential issue | 🟠 Major | ⚡ Quick winLogic issue: array-based equations lose their structure during editing.
When a user edits a multi-part equation (like the circle example with
['sqrt(9-x^2)', '-sqrt(9-x^2)']), this function has a subtle bug:
- Line 846 immediately sets
eq.raw = val(converting the array to a single comma-separated string)- Line 849's check
Array.isArray(eq.raw)will always befalsesince line 846 already overwrote it with a string- This means
compileEqreceives a single string like"sqrt(9-x^2), -sqrt(9-x^2)"instead of an arrayThe result: editing a circle breaks it into an invalid single expression rather than two valid half-circle expressions.

751-756: 🩺 Stability & Availability | 🟡 Minor | ⚡ Quick winGuard degenerate pinch distances before zooming.
If the two touch points coincide,
d2becomes zero andtouch.dist / d2becomesInfinity, corruptingVand breaking subsequent rendering. Ignore or reset the gesture whend2 <= 0before callingzoomAround.🤖 Prompt for AI Agents

611-614: 🎯 Functional Correctness | 🟠 Major | 🏗️ Heavy liftAdapt curve sampling to the visible x-range.
Because
stepsis based only on canvas width,dxgrows as the x-range expands. After zooming out, functions such assin(x)andtan(x)can be undersampled, causing aliasing, missing oscillations, or incorrect curves. Use adaptive subdivision or a bounded x-step with a maximum sample cap, and add a zoomed-out trigonometric regression test.🤖 Prompt for AI Agents
